Visit to an NGO-run free boarding school in India

Publication date:2023-05-17
 
Dr. Archana Shrestha Joshi (AMDA Headquarters)
 
In recent years, AMDA has been providing educational support to a free boarding school in Bodhgaya, India. The school is run by Jeanamitabh, a local NGO dedicated to uplifting the lives of children from impoverished communities. 

In August 2022, AMDA distributed school textbooks to its 111 students (out of 144 students). In addition, a set of stationery was provided to every student learning at the school. Moreover, sanitary napkins, first aid medicine, as well as office supplies were donated on this occasion.
 
In November of the same year, AMDA President Dr. Shigeru Suganami paid a visit to the school during his tour in India. The students and school staff welcomed him with bouquets and traditional Indian ornaments, whose flowers were grown by themselves. 

His visit coincided with the birthday of Jawaharlal Nehru, the first prime minister of India, which is designated as a national day of celebration. Also known as “Children’s Day,” Indian students get together to give musical performances and academic presentations on this very day.

Dr. Suganami also handed new school uniforms to 45 students who were unable to afford them. “I am very happy to receive the new uniform since my old one got worn out,” one of the students said.

After the donation ceremony was over, an exchange meeting was held for both students and Dr. Suganami. Asked what their dreams were, the students expressed their hopes of becoming doctors and school teachers in the future, with some revealing their wishes to study abroad. 

As the day came to a close, they planted a jackfruit tree and a jamun tree in the schoolyard to commemorate the event. Jamun is locally treasured as “a divine fruit” for its abundant health benefits, and is only available during the monsoon season. 

The school has been growing many beautiful flowers and fruit trees as part of its efforts to enrich the greenery of the local community.
